What is MSU best known for?

Asked by: Bernie Bins  |  Last update: October 22, 2023
Score: 4.9/5 (69 votes)

Michigan State University (MSU) offers over 200 academic programs at its East Lansing, Michigan campus. MSU is well known for its academic programs in education and agriculture, and the university pioneered the studies of packaging, horticulture and music therapy.

Is MSU a top 10 school?

Michigan State University's ranking in the 2022-2023 edition of Best Colleges is National Universities, #77. Its in-state tuition and fees are $14,850; out-of-state tuition and fees are $40,662. Michigan State University was the first land-grant institution in the country and became a model for similar schools.

What is MSU ranked #1 for?

Michigan State University is #1 in the nation for elementary and secondary teacher education, according to U.S. News and World Report. The accolade comes from the 2023-2024 U.S. News Best Education Schools, which also heralded MSU as #1 for curriculum and instruction for the fifth straight year.

Is MSU a Ivy League school?

MSU has about 4,500 faculty and 6,000 staff members, and a student/faculty ratio of 19:1. Listed as a Public Ivy, Michigan State is a member of the Association of American Universities.

What is a good GPA to get into MSU?

Average GPA: 3.75

(Most schools use a weighted GPA out of 4.0, though some report an unweighted GPA. With a GPA of 3.75, Michigan State requires you to be above average in your high school class. You'll need at least a mix of A's and B's, with more A's than B's.

What is the average acceptance rate for MSU?

What is the acceptance rate for MSU? Michigan State admissions is somewhat selective with an acceptance rate of 83%. Students that get into Michigan State have an average SAT score between 1100-1320 or an average ACT score of 23-29. The regular admissions application deadline for Michigan State is rolling.

What is MSU looking for in applicants?

First-year admission is based on:

The strength and quality of your curriculum. Recent trends in your academic performance. Your class rank. Your ACT or SAT results — however, please note that MSU is test optional and prospective students have the option to apply to MSU without submitting an ACT or SAT score.
